How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lincolnw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lincolnwood Studio Apartments | $2,304 | $1,817 | $5,590 |
Lincolnw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,136 | $1,295 | $6,450 |
Lincolnw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,166 | $1,500 | $9,842 |
Lincolnw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,792 | $1,600 | $4,720 |
Lincolnw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,068 | $2,475 | $3,750 |

Getting Around Lincolnwood, IL
Walk Score®
70 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
66 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
9 / 100
Minimal Transit
It may be possible to get on a bus
